.elementor-7 .elementor-element.elementor-element-bc1ef09{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--overflow:hidden;}.elementor-widget-image .widget-image-caption{color:var( --e-global-color-text );font-family:var( --e-global-typography-text-font-family ), Katmon;font-weight:var( --e-global-typography-text-font-weight );}body:not(.rtl) .elementor-7 .elementor-element.elementor-element-3cee36b{left:0px;}body.rtl .elementor-7 .elementor-element.elementor-element-3cee36b{right:0px;}.elementor-7 .elementor-element.elementor-element-3cee36b{top:0px;--e-transform-origin-x:center;--e-transform-origin-y:center;}.elementor-7 .elementor-element.elementor-element-50a4e60{--display:flex;}.elementor-widget-heading .elementor-heading-title{font-family:var( --e-global-typography-primary-font-family ), Katmon;font-weight:var( --e-global-typography-primary-font-weight );color:var( --e-global-color-primary );}.elementor-7 .elementor-element.elementor-element-38871da .elementor-heading-title{font-family:"Katmon", Katmon;font-weight:600;color:#EEEEEE;}@media(max-width:767px){.elementor-7 .elementor-element.elementor-element-bc1ef09:not(.elementor-motion-effects-element-type-background), .elementor-7 .elementor-element.elementor-element-bc1ef09 >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-image:url("https://hang.ussl.co/wp-content/uploads/2026/03/Empty-Background-no-texture-scaled.webp");background-position:center center;background-repeat:no-repeat;background-size:cover;}.elementor-7 .elementor-element.elementor-element-bc1ef09{--content-width:100%;--min-height:100vh;--align-items:center;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--padding-top:0px;--padding-bottom:0px;--padding-left:0px;--padding-right:0px;--z-index:1;}.elementor-7 .elementor-element.elementor-element-3cee36b{margin:-23px 0px calc(var(--kit-widget-spacing, 0px) + 0px) 0px;}.elementor-7 .elementor-element.elementor-element-50a4e60{--width:78%;--min-height:100vh;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--justify-content:flex-start;--gap:0px 0px;--row-gap:0px;--column-gap:0px;--padding-top:27px;--padding-bottom:0px;--padding-left:0px;--padding-right:0px;--z-index:2;}.elementor-7 .elementor-element.elementor-element-38871da{text-align:center;}.elementor-7 .elementor-element.elementor-element-38871da .elementor-heading-title{font-size:22px;}.elementor-7 .elementor-element.elementor-element-933c9ad{margin:-71px 0px calc(var(--kit-widget-spacing, 0px) + 0px) 0px;}body.elementor-page-7:not(.elementor-motion-effects-element-type-background), body.elementor-page-7 >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-image:url("https://hang.ussl.co/wp-content/uploads/2026/03/Background-no-texture-no-frame-scaled.webp");background-position:center center;background-repeat:no-repeat;}}/* Start custom CSS for image, class: .elementor-element-5ea5ed8 *//* ============================
   IMAGE 1 - GLITCH EFFECT
   Blue & White | TV Distortion
   Glitch every 1.5s
   ============================ */

.elementor-7 .elementor-element.elementor-element-5ea5ed8 img {
  animation:
    glitch-shake-1   4.5s infinite 0s,
    glitch-strips-1  4.5s infinite 1.5s,
    glitch-vhs-1     4.5s infinite 3s;
}

/* ---- TYPE 1: Shake + Jitter ---- */
@keyframes glitch-shake-1 {
  0%, 88%, 100% {
    transform: translate(0, 0) skewX(0deg);
    filter: none;
  }
  89% {
    transform: translate(-4px, 1px) skewX(-1.2deg);
    filter: brightness(1.15) contrast(1.1) hue-rotate(200deg) saturate(0.35);
  }
  89.8% {
    transform: translate(5px, -2px) skewX(1deg);
    filter: brightness(1.35) contrast(1.15) hue-rotate(212deg) saturate(0.2);
  }
  90.5% {
    transform: translate(-3px, 2px) skewX(-0.6deg);
    filter: brightness(0.92) contrast(1.08) hue-rotate(205deg);
  }
  91.2% {
    transform: translate(4px, 0px) skewX(0.9deg);
    filter: brightness(1.25) hue-rotate(196deg) saturate(0.28);
  }
  92% {
    transform: translate(-2px, -1px) skewX(0.3deg);
    filter: brightness(1.08) hue-rotate(202deg) saturate(0.15);
  }
  93% {
    transform: translate(1px, 1px) skewX(-0.2deg);
    filter: brightness(1.03) hue-rotate(200deg);
  }
  94% {
    transform: translate(0, 0) skewX(0deg);
    filter: none;
  }
}

/* ---- TYPE 2: VHS Strip Tear ---- */
@keyframes glitch-strips-1 {
  0%, 88%, 100% {
    clip-path: none;
    transform: translate(0);
    filter: none;
    box-shadow: none;
  }
  89% {
    clip-path: polygon(0 5%, 100% 5%, 100% 11%, 0 11%);
    transform: translate(6px, 0);
    filter: brightness(1.7) saturate(0.05) hue-rotate(202deg);
    box-shadow: -6px 0 0 rgba(180, 220, 255, 0.6), 6px 0 0 rgba(255,255,255,0.3);
  }
  89.8% {
    clip-path: polygon(0 42%, 100% 42%, 100% 51%, 0 51%);
    transform: translate(-7px, 0);
    filter: brightness(1.9) saturate(0.1) hue-rotate(208deg);
    box-shadow: 7px 0 0 rgba(255, 255, 255, 0.5), -4px 0 0 rgba(150,200,255,0.4);
  }
  90.6% {
    clip-path: polygon(0 68%, 100% 68%, 100% 75%, 0 75%);
    transform: translate(5px, 0);
    filter: brightness(1.6) saturate(0) hue-rotate(206deg);
    box-shadow: -5px 0 0 rgba(200, 225, 255, 0.55);
  }
  91.4% {
    clip-path: polygon(0 25%, 100% 25%, 100% 30%, 0 30%);
    transform: translate(-4px, 0);
    filter: brightness(1.75) saturate(0.12) hue-rotate(200deg);
    box-shadow: 4px 0 0 rgba(255, 255, 255, 0.35);
  }
  92.2% {
    clip-path: polygon(0 82%, 100% 82%, 100% 87%, 0 87%);
    transform: translate(3px, 0);
    filter: brightness(1.5) saturate(0.08) hue-rotate(204deg);
    box-shadow: -3px 0 0 rgba(170, 210, 255, 0.45);
  }
  93.5% {
    clip-path: none;
    transform: translate(0);
    filter: none;
    box-shadow: none;
  }
}

/* ---- TYPE 3: Chromatic Aberration ---- */
@keyframes glitch-vhs-1 {
  0%, 88%, 100% {
    filter: none;
    transform: translate(0) skewX(0);
    opacity: 1;
  }
  88.8% {
    filter: brightness(1.2) contrast(1.12)
            drop-shadow(4px 0 0 rgba(160, 215, 255, 0.95))
            drop-shadow(-4px 0 0 rgba(255, 255, 255, 0.8));
    transform: translate(2px, 0) skewX(-0.4deg);
    opacity: 0.94;
  }
  89.6% {
    filter: brightness(1.35) contrast(1.18)
            drop-shadow(-6px 0 0 rgba(130, 195, 255, 1))
            drop-shadow(6px 0 0 rgba(255, 255, 255, 0.9))
            drop-shadow(0 2px 0 rgba(180, 220, 255, 0.4));
    transform: translate(-4px, 1px) skewX(0.6deg);
    opacity: 0.88;
  }
  90.4% {
    filter: brightness(0.88) contrast(1.22)
            drop-shadow(5px 0 0 rgba(190, 228, 255, 0.85))
            drop-shadow(-3px 0 0 rgba(255, 255, 255, 0.7));
    transform: translate(3px, -2px) skewX(-0.3deg);
    opacity: 0.96;
  }
  91.2% {
    filter: brightness(1.45) contrast(1.08)
            drop-shadow(-7px 0 0 rgba(100, 175, 255, 0.95))
            drop-shadow(5px 0 0 rgba(255, 255, 255, 0.95))
            drop-shadow(0 -2px 0 rgba(200, 230, 255, 0.5));
    transform: translate(-3px, 0) skewX(0.5deg);
    opacity: 0.86;
  }
  92% {
    filter: brightness(1.15) contrast(1.05)
            drop-shadow(3px 0 0 rgba(180, 218, 255, 0.6))
            drop-shadow(-2px 0 0 rgba(255, 255, 255, 0.5));
    transform: translate(1px, 0) skewX(-0.15deg);
    opacity: 0.97;
  }
  93% {
    filter: brightness(1.05)
            drop-shadow(1px 0 0 rgba(200, 225, 255, 0.3));
    transform: translate(0) skewX(0);
    opacity: 1;
  }
  94% {
    filter: none;
    transform: translate(0) skewX(0);
    opacity: 1;
  }
}/* End custom CSS */
/* Start custom CSS for image, class: .elementor-element-933c9ad *//* ============================
   IMAGE 2 - GLITCH EFFECT
   Blue & White | TV Distortion
   Offset by 0.75s from Image 1
   ============================ */

.elementor-7 .elementor-element.elementor-element-933c9ad img {
  animation:
    glitch-shake-2   4.5s infinite 0.75s,
    glitch-strips-2  4.5s infinite 2.25s,
    glitch-vhs-2     4.5s infinite 3.75s;
}

/* ---- TYPE 1: Shake + Jitter ---- */
@keyframes glitch-shake-2 {
  0%, 88%, 100% {
    transform: translate(0, 0) skewX(0deg);
    filter: none;
  }
  89% {
    transform: translate(4px, -1px) skewX(1.2deg);
    filter: brightness(1.15) contrast(1.1) hue-rotate(200deg) saturate(0.35);
  }
  89.8% {
    transform: translate(-5px, 2px) skewX(-1deg);
    filter: brightness(1.35) contrast(1.15) hue-rotate(212deg) saturate(0.2);
  }
  90.5% {
    transform: translate(3px, -2px) skewX(0.6deg);
    filter: brightness(0.92) contrast(1.08) hue-rotate(205deg);
  }
  91.2% {
    transform: translate(-4px, 0px) skewX(-0.9deg);
    filter: brightness(1.25) hue-rotate(196deg) saturate(0.28);
  }
  92% {
    transform: translate(2px, 1px) skewX(-0.3deg);
    filter: brightness(1.08) hue-rotate(202deg) saturate(0.15);
  }
  93% {
    transform: translate(-1px, -1px) skewX(0.2deg);
    filter: brightness(1.03) hue-rotate(200deg);
  }
  94% {
    transform: translate(0, 0) skewX(0deg);
    filter: none;
  }
}

/* ---- TYPE 2: VHS Strip Tear ---- */
@keyframes glitch-strips-2 {
  0%, 88%, 100% {
    clip-path: none;
    transform: translate(0);
    filter: none;
    box-shadow: none;
  }
  89% {
    clip-path: polygon(0 12%, 100% 12%, 100% 18%, 0 18%);
    transform: translate(-6px, 0);
    filter: brightness(1.7) saturate(0.05) hue-rotate(202deg);
    box-shadow: 6px 0 0 rgba(180, 220, 255, 0.6), -6px 0 0 rgba(255,255,255,0.3);
  }
  89.8% {
    clip-path: polygon(0 55%, 100% 55%, 100% 64%, 0 64%);
    transform: translate(7px, 0);
    filter: brightness(1.9) saturate(0.1) hue-rotate(208deg);
    box-shadow: -7px 0 0 rgba(255, 255, 255, 0.5), 4px 0 0 rgba(150,200,255,0.4);
  }
  90.6% {
    clip-path: polygon(0 30%, 100% 30%, 100% 37%, 0 37%);
    transform: translate(-5px, 0);
    filter: brightness(1.6) saturate(0) hue-rotate(206deg);
    box-shadow: 5px 0 0 rgba(200, 225, 255, 0.55);
  }
  91.4% {
    clip-path: polygon(0 75%, 100% 75%, 100% 80%, 0 80%);
    transform: translate(4px, 0);
    filter: brightness(1.75) saturate(0.12) hue-rotate(200deg);
    box-shadow: -4px 0 0 rgba(255, 255, 255, 0.35);
  }
  92.2% {
    clip-path: polygon(0 18%, 100% 18%, 100% 23%, 0 23%);
    transform: translate(-3px, 0);
    filter: brightness(1.5) saturate(0.08) hue-rotate(204deg);
    box-shadow: 3px 0 0 rgba(170, 210, 255, 0.45);
  }
  93.5% {
    clip-path: none;
    transform: translate(0);
    filter: none;
    box-shadow: none;
  }
}

/* ---- TYPE 3: Chromatic Aberration ---- */
@keyframes glitch-vhs-2 {
  0%, 88%, 100% {
    filter: none;
    transform: translate(0) skewX(0);
    opacity: 1;
  }
  88.8% {
    filter: brightness(1.2) contrast(1.12)
            drop-shadow(-4px 0 0 rgba(160, 215, 255, 0.95))
            drop-shadow(4px 0 0 rgba(255, 255, 255, 0.8));
    transform: translate(-2px, 0) skewX(0.4deg);
    opacity: 0.94;
  }
  89.6% {
    filter: brightness(1.35) contrast(1.18)
            drop-shadow(6px 0 0 rgba(130, 195, 255, 1))
            drop-shadow(-6px 0 0 rgba(255, 255, 255, 0.9))
            drop-shadow(0 -2px 0 rgba(180, 220, 255, 0.4));
    transform: translate(4px, -1px) skewX(-0.6deg);
    opacity: 0.88;
  }
  90.4% {
    filter: brightness(0.88) contrast(1.22)
            drop-shadow(-5px 0 0 rgba(190, 228, 255, 0.85))
            drop-shadow(3px 0 0 rgba(255, 255, 255, 0.7));
    transform: translate(-3px, 2px) skewX(0.3deg);
    opacity: 0.96;
  }
  91.2% {
    filter: brightness(1.45) contrast(1.08)
            drop-shadow(7px 0 0 rgba(100, 175, 255, 0.95))
            drop-shadow(-5px 0 0 rgba(255, 255, 255, 0.95))
            drop-shadow(0 2px 0 rgba(200, 230, 255, 0.5));
    transform: translate(3px, 0) skewX(-0.5deg);
    opacity: 0.86;
  }
  92% {
    filter: brightness(1.15) contrast(1.05)
            drop-shadow(-3px 0 0 rgba(180, 218, 255, 0.6))
            drop-shadow(2px 0 0 rgba(255, 255, 255, 0.5));
    transform: translate(-1px, 0) skewX(0.15deg);
    opacity: 0.97;
  }
  93% {
    filter: brightness(1.05)
            drop-shadow(-1px 0 0 rgba(200, 225, 255, 0.3));
    transform: translate(0) skewX(0);
    opacity: 1;
  }
  94% {
    filter: none;
    transform: translate(0) skewX(0);
    opacity: 1;
  }
}/* End custom CSS */
/* Start Custom Fonts CSS */@font-face {
	font-family: 'Katmon';
	font-style: normal;
	font-weight: normal;
	font-display: auto;
	src: url('https://hang.ussl.co/wp-content/uploads/2026/03/FUP-Katamon-Regular.woff2') format('woff2');
}
@font-face {
	font-family: 'Katmon';
	font-style: normal;
	font-weight: 100;
	font-display: auto;
	src: url('https://hang.ussl.co/wp-content/uploads/2026/03/FUP-Katamon-Light.woff2') format('woff2');
}
@font-face {
	font-family: 'Katmon';
	font-style: normal;
	font-weight: 900;
	font-display: auto;
	src: url('https://hang.ussl.co/wp-content/uploads/2026/03/FUP-Katamon-ExtraBold.woff2') format('woff2');
}
@font-face {
	font-family: 'Katmon';
	font-style: normal;
	font-weight: normal;
	font-display: auto;
	src: ;
}
@font-face {
	font-family: 'Katmon';
	font-style: normal;
	font-weight: bold;
	font-display: auto;
	src: url('https://hang.ussl.co/wp-content/uploads/2026/03/FUP-Katamon-Bold.woff2') format('woff2');
}
@font-face {
	font-family: 'Katmon';
	font-style: normal;
	font-weight: 400;
	font-display: auto;
	src: url('https://hang.ussl.co/wp-content/uploads/2026/03/FUP-Katamon-Medium.woff2') format('woff2');
}
/* End Custom Fonts CSS */